Social work is a profession in which practitioners work directly with individuals, families, and groups, helping people cope, change, and solve problems in all facets of their daily lives. Social workers also work with community stakeholders, organizations, neighborhoods and communities, and in activities such as community ... Here are some of the special requirements we have found across the 8 university websites we analyzed: An Accredited Bachelor’s Degree. All the programs required students to have a bachelor’s degree from an accredited institution before they can be considered for admission.
